Sarah O’Leary Returns To Initiative As Melbourne MD

 Sarah O’Leary is returning to Initiative to serve as the agency’s Melbourne managing director.

O’Leary rejoins Initiative having previously led Rufus, the agency’s bespoke Amazon offering.

She departed in early 2025 following her relocation to Melbourne to join Zenith, where she most recently served as the Publicis agency’s chief client partner.

Her career also includes senior roles at Atomic 212 and Havas, building a reputation for strong client leadership underpinned by deep expertise across planning and trading.

As a people-first leader, O’Leary is known for building high-performing teams and strong client partnerships, aligning closely with Initiative’s culture-first operating model.

Her appointment reflects the agency’s continued focus on leadership, team development, and delivering growth for clients.

Paige Wheaton, national MD of Initiative Australia said: “You don’t always get the chance to bring someone back like this, so we’re incredibly lucky to have Sarah rejoin us. She knows Initiative inside out.”

“She’s a natural leader who brings energy, honesty and real commercial instinct to the table, and I couldn’t think of a better person to lead Initiative in Melbourne.”

Of her return to the business, O’Leary added: “Opportunities like this don’t come along often. I’ve watched Omnicom Oceania and Omnicom Media’s evolution closely, and the chance to be part of what the business is building across the region was incredibly compelling.

“The ambition is clear; the team is exceptional and there is genuine momentum behind the vision. I’m excited to get started and help drive the next phase of growth.”
